    ​Active in the British 80's nu pop scene. Brilliant were formed when Killing Joke's Martin Glover (Youth) left his previous group. Along with Ben Watkins (later, Juno Reactor) and Jimmy Cauty (later the one half of The KLF) they started the group, releasing singles from 1982 to 1984. The first line up was completed with Marcus Myers and Guy Pratt, later in Icehouse. In their first four years of their existence,  they hosted a roster of over 30 musicians! The final line-up found them as a trio   with June Montana at vocals, later a one-hit wonder dance diva with which they released their sole album with a Stock, Aitken & Waterman production. Among their hits were James Brown's "It's A Man's World" and the 1963 hit for Skeeter Davis, "The End Of The World".

Custerd

 

'Custerd' was started as a side project of the 'Transit Kings'

(Alex Paterson, former Orb member/co-founder Jimmy Cauty and Pink Floyd bassist Guy Pratt),

releasing a 12" that should have been followed by an album, "Ear Cake 3000",

which unfortunately never materialized.

Transit Kings

 

The 'Transit Kings' are a British electronic music group consisting of Alex Paterson and Jimmy Cauty, inventors of Ambient House (later to become The Orb and The KLF),

 Guy Pratt (long time post-waters Pink Floyd bassist, occasional Orb contributor and

renowned session player) and Dom Beken artists (programmer/producer,

Orb contributor and long time collaborator and assistant to Guy)

met at Gunpoint (the studio built by Guy and Dom) at London’s Townhouse Studios.
Cauty left the band in 2004 to work on other projects; the official website has him listed as on

"Co-Pilot (on extended leave): Graybeard". He is, however, listed as a composer on

seven of the Transit Kings' debut album's twelve tracks

In 2002 Jimmy Cauty and James Fogarty launched BLACKSMOKE, followed in 2003 with the 'Post Terrorist Modernism' EP.

BLACKSMOKE also completed some remixes (The Dandy Warhols, A-ha, The (International) Noise Conspiracy, Emperor, The Bloodhound Gang, Goldie Lookin Chain, Les Six, Cradle of Filth and remixed the theme for the film 'Herbie : Fully Loaded...).

In 2005, Jimmy left BLACKSMOKE in to create Stamps (of Mass Destruction) and post-apocalyptic dioramas, and James continued project alone - but changed name to The Blacksmoke Organisation. In 2007, James suspended all musical activity for BLACKSMOKE.
In 2021, James reactivated BLACKSMOKE in order to create some new original music along with Thomas Touzimsky and other collaborators.

P.S. Although James wrote the music for the post-BLACKSMOKE project 'Danger Global Warming project', this is not BLACKSMOKE material, and neither are any subsequent remixes - these should be attributed to The Blacksmoke Organisation, which features no founding members of BLACKSMOKE.

The Post-Terrorist Modernism EP was a free 4-track EP released by Jimmy Cauty and James Fogarty as The Blacksmoke Organization in November 2003.

During 2003 the self-titled “occasional art collective and musical group” had already shared various tracks for download through their website. The EP was first teased when Blacksmoke released Silent Night, another free track released on 11 Sep 2003 as a response to the second anniversary of 9-11.

We have just done an EP called ‘Fuck the Fucking Fuckers’. It is a concept EP, the concept being fuck America basically and fuck weapons of mass destruction. It is like a protest record. It is the kind of record that you would want to put on if you are going to go out on a riot. We do feel quite angry about what has been going on with the war.
Jimmy Cauty (Undercover.com.au, 11 Sep 2003)

Following a 15-minute Breezeblock session broadcast on BBC Radio 1 in September they released their renamed Post-Terrorist Modernism EP free of charge two months later.

The EP included previously released tracks USA USA and Fuck The Fucking Fuckers (a remix of Gimpo Gimpo as performed at the M25 London Orbital event) along new track Blacksmoke Rising of which early bits and pieces had been hidden throughout the official Blacksmoke website. Also featured on the release is an alternate version of Silent Night which had been cut from the aforementioned BBC session, probably to not upset listeners.

The download for Post-Terrorist Modernism also included printable covers and CD labels, allowing listeners to create their own physical version. The cover art of an exploding Big Ben was also released separately, causing a stir in a couple of British newspapers.

The EP can still be downloaded from Archive.org for free. A limited edition of 50 cassette tapes got re-released in April 2021, including a remix of Emperor’s ‘I Am The Black Wizards’.

Jem Finer and Jimmy Cauty’s Local Psycho and the Hurdy-Gurdy Orchestra have released their debut single The Hurdy-Gurdy Song on 12” vinyl and via streaming/download platforms. As well as the original, The Hurdy-Gurdy Song now comes backed with a trio of new mixes, and new artwork by Jimmy Cauty.
 
The Back to the 90s mix has all of the chaos and euphoria and gurdiness of the original Hurdy Gurdy Song, only twice as much of it - more chaos, more euphoria and much more gurdiness. 
 
The original was always a certified banger custom made to get to No 1 in Bavaria. Now it’s been remixed by the hottest band from Germany’s largest state, Mothers of the New Stone Age. In a cultural exchange that has been officially twinned with Local Psycho) into (nearly) six minutes of stunning slow motion sound, completely reimagining the original's addictive madness as a super heavy low frequency medieval ambient dub. 
 
Finally, the Stone Club mix sees the people behind the country's hottest megalithic fanclub deconstruct and pull and reshape The Hurdy Gurdy Song before adding trippy vocal samples and seismic distortion to create a spaced out spiritual ambient dronescape that stretches out over twenty plus minutes of supreme, beautiful, horizontal oddness.
